Industry Challenges
Engaging Digital-Native Learners
Students raised on interactive media expect learning experiences that match the engagement levels of the technology they use daily — static lectures and textbooks often fail to hold attention.
Making Abstract Concepts Tangible
Complex subjects in science, history, engineering, and medicine are difficult to grasp through two-dimensional materials alone — learners need spatial, hands-on experiences.
Scalable Content Delivery
Educational institutions need technology that supports curriculum updates and content changes without requiring complete system overhauls each academic year.
Inclusive Learning for All Abilities
Technology must accommodate diverse learning styles and abilities, providing visual, auditory, and kinesthetic pathways to knowledge.
How Immersive Technology Solves Them
Holographic Visualisation of Complex Subjects
Holographic displays present scientific models, historical reconstructions, and engineering systems as three-dimensional objects that students can examine from every angle.
Interactive Learning Surfaces
Projection-based interactive floors and walls transform classrooms into collaborative learning environments where students physically engage with educational content.
Spatial Learning Environments
Immersive projection systems create full-room learning environments that transport students to historical periods, scientific environments, and geographical locations.
Digital Artefact Libraries
3D digitisation creates detailed digital replicas of specimens, artefacts, and models that can be explored holographically without risk to original objects.
